COO Playbook for Sustainable Supply Chain Optimization with IoT Analytics: The Tech Stack
Pick tools that scale. Start simple.
- Sensors: Temperature trackers for perishables. GPS for fleet. Vibration detectors on machinery.
- Platforms: AWS IoT or Azure IoT Hub for data ingestion. They handle petabytes without sweat.
- Analytics: Machine learning models predict demand. Tools like Google Cloud’s Vertex AI flag anomalies.
Integration’s key. Link it to your ERP. I’ve wired SAP with IoT in weeks—orders flow seamless.

Step-by-Step Action Plan: Build Your COO Playbook for Sustainable Supply Chain Optimization with IoT Analytics
Beginners, listen up. This is your roadmap. No fluff.
- Audit Your Chain: Map every node. Suppliers in Ohio? Warehouses in Texas? List pain points—spoilage, delays. Takes a week with your team.
- Pilot Sensors: Deploy 50 units on high-impact spots. Trucks first. Use off-the-shelf like those from Cisco IoT. Track for 30 days.
- Feed the Data Beast: Pipe into a dashboard. Tableau or Power BI. Set alerts for temps over 40°F or idle times exceeding 15 minutes.
- Optimize with Analytics: Run models. Predictive routing cuts miles 20%. Dynamic inventory? Slash overstock 25%. Tweak weekly.
- Go Green, Measure It: Calculate emissions via IoT metrics. Tools auto-report Scope 1-3. Benchmark against DOE standards.
- Scale and Iterate: Rollout firm-wide after pilot ROI. Train staff. Review quarterly.

Common Mistakes & How to Fix Them in Your COO Playbook
Pitfalls kill momentum. Here’s what I’ve fixed for clients.
Mistake 1: Data Silos. IoT spits gigabytes. But if ERP ignores it? Useless.
Fix: Mandate API integrations day one. Test flows end-to-end.
Mistake 2: Ignoring Edge Computing. Cloud latency tanks real-time alerts. A delayed reroute? Wasted fuel.
Fix: Process data at the edge. Devices decide locally, sync later.
Mistake 3: Forgetting People. Tech’s shiny. Staff resists.
Fix: Hands-on workshops. Show their wins—shorter shifts from smarter routes.
Mistake 4: Chasing Perfection. Full rollout flops without pilots.
Fix: 10% of chain first. Prove 15% savings, then expand.
The kicker? Most skip cybersecurity. IoT’s a hacker magnet. Encrypt everything. Use zero-trust models.
